Here is the history of the vine, through ancient, biblical and classical times up to today. Here, seen through the life of a typical Burgundy winegrower, is the arduous annual work cycle of the vineyards-plowing, pruning, training, tying, harrowing, sprayng, protecting against storm, frost and disease-and then, amid merrymaking and traditional celebrations, the harvesting and wine making. Here too are the special methods used in producing famous wines such as the Champagne of France. the Sherry of Spain. the Port of Portugal, the Tokay of Hungary, the Chianti of Italy-all wine types long since duplicated, in name if not in quality, in many other countries. Board. Condizione: Good. No Jacket. First Edition. The Wine Book by Dorozynski, Alexander Golden Press, 1969, lst, 317 pages Hardback in good+ condition NO dust jacket. Text clean and unmarked, binding tight. Cover very clean red with embossed grape vines. Covers wine making around the world. Chapters are: France, Western Europe, North Africa, Greece and the Near East, Eastern Europe, United States, Latin America, South Africa and Australia. Sections on Wine appreciation, recipes, and origins of wine. Maps color and B&W photos, loaded with wine lore and history. Book.
